Never in a million years did I think it would be Ian Parker who saved me....
I know I should stay away from Ian Parker.
But when my drug-dealing stepdad kicks me out, I have nowhere to go. Squatting in an abandoned shed on Ian’s grandpa’s farm seems like as good a plan as any.
Ian finds me there, of course, and he insists on me moving into his spare room. I should say no, but the appeal of a roof and a warm bed is too much. Not to mention Ian’s brown eyes and strong arms.
We’re nothing alike, but the spark between us is undeniable. My life is finally looking up.
Until I call the cops on my stepdad and unintentionally get my pregnant mom arrested.
Now I have to sacrifice my dreams to take care of my mom’s baby. She’s the only family I have left. Meanwhile, Ian’s band is taking off; his dreams are coming true.
Ian is my one chance at love. I just hope he doesn’t become the one chance that got away.

The Wreckage of Us was a good small town rock star romance.
Hazel and Ian didn't get off to the best start. Each coming from different walks of life they never interacted until Hazel came looking for work on Big Pa's farm.
Hazel was so down on her luck she just couldn't win but she never gave up and worked herself every minute to get what she wanted. At first Ian was honestly quite a tool but did a complete 180 (almost unbelievably so) once things started to progress with Hazel. Lots of things went down in this book and it almost felt like it was a few books combined together. Overall I enjoyed the story and I like Brittainy Cherry's writing.

Ian is a hard working. He lives and works on his grandparents farm. He is also in a band called Wreckage. Just as a relationship between the two has just begun Ian is being given the opportunity for him and his band members to make it big which will take Ian away from Hazel while he is on tour.
Hazel I LOVED! Wow did my heart break for her! She is incredibly resilient and is a fighter. She was mature beyond her years. Her mother has a drug addiction and her abusive step-father is a nasty piece of work and she was kicked out of her home at 18 years old. She doesn’t have any where to go and ends up staying at the farm.
There were some big obstacles to climb and their HEA is not an easy one and well I thought some of it could have been handled differently the plot was strong and I was completely invested in the characters.
So why 4 stars? Almost every book I have read by this author I have been wowed by the characters, by the message, by the romance and while this story was good it wasn’t the caliber of writing I am used to from this author. There were some parts that were predictable and I was just left wanting a bit more.
Regardless I still loved it. I will forever and always read everything this author puts out. Her writing is that good and although not my favourite this is still an incredible read and I recommend it.
Stella Bloom and Rock Engle did an incredible job narrating this. Their voices are full of passion and emotion and I enjoyed the listening experience.
